Our yard is being overrun by garter snakes! We have always had some snakes in the yard but this year they are everywhere and over the weekend we saw MANY, MANY smaller snakes coming from under some plants in our yard (as if they were young snakes leaving a nest). I don't mind having a few snakes around but am worried about them getting into our house or crawl space. Would appreciate more info on them (will they leave the nest and venture off? will they return next year to the same spot?) and some help in getting rid of them. Thanks!

The snakes will disperse on their own. Are you having any trouble with them getting into the house?
